Web15 sep. 2024 · Please contact the park staff to discuss the area and obtain a permit if metal detecting is allowed. Some parks are unstaffed, so to locate the closest park office to the park you're interested in, call 1-800-551-6949, 8 a.m. to 5 p.m., Monday-Friday.
